I've been making do with a cheap set of tins for a while now and although they are nice and straight etc they are not heavy (even know they were advertised to be) and i find that they heat too quickly on the edges. I want to invest in a new set but in the UK there are two common manufacturers, PME and Invicta. Both look good but anyone know if there is any difference to be aware of?

The PME one I has takes longer to cook and the bottom browns faster than the sides, so I would go for the Invicta. I also have some invicta style ones from ebay and they are very good too.
